WebSince the Earth formed, the upper mantle has lost 40–90% of its carbon by evaporation and transport to the core in iron compounds. The most rigorous estimate gives a carbon content of 30 parts per million (ppm). The lower mantle is expected to be much less depleted – about 350 ppm. The crust may be divided into 2 types: oceanic and continental. Oceanic crust is usually 5-10 km thick and continental crust is 33 km thick on average. Beneath the crust is the mantle. The mantle is made up of Si and O, like the crust, but it contains more Fe and Mg.

WebThe oceanic crust, which is rich in basalts from volcanic activity, show distinct components that provides information about the evolution of the Earth's interior over the geologic timescale. Incompatible trace elements become depleted when mantle melts and become enriched in oceanic or continental crust through volcanic activity.
